The area of a rectangle is 36 sq.cm. If the length of the rectangle is 9 cm, then calculate its breadth

Solutions :-

Given :
The area of a rectangle is 36 sq. cm.
The length of the rectangle is 9 cm.

Let the breadth of rectangle be x cm.


Find the breadth of rectangle :-

We know that,
Area of rectangle = (Length × Breadth) sq. cm
=> 36 = 9 × x
=> 36/9 = x = 4


Hence,
Breadth of the rectangle = 4 cm.
